1. 程式人生 > >iOS-使用imageView新增圖片無法展示的三種解決方案

iOS-使用imageView新增圖片無法展示的三種解決方案

問題描述:

1.未使用Assets.xcassets新增照片,是直接把圖片拉到某資料夾下的
2.圖片格式為.png
3.具體程式碼如下,背景色可以展示:

bgView = UIImageView(frame: CGRect(x: 0,y: 0,width: kScreenW,height: kScreenH))
bgView.image = UIImage(named:"抽獎背景")
bgView.isUserInteractionEnabled = true
bgView.backgroundColor = UIColor.purple
self.view.addSubview(bgView)

解決方案:

1.新增圖片到專案中時,選擇1而不是2:

1

2.在Build Phases 中手動新增圖片:

2

3.修改Compress PNG Files的設定:

3